Enhancing Aviation Safety with the L 810 LED Obstruction Light
The L 810 LED obstruction light is a critical component in aviation safety, designed to mark tall structures such as telecommunication towers, wind turbines, and skyscrapers. These lights ensure that pilots can easily identify potential obstacles, reducing the risk of collisions, especially during low visibility conditions. With advancements in LED technology, the L 810 model offers superior performance, energy efficiency, and durability compared to traditional lighting solutions.
Key Features of the L 810 LED Obstruction Light
1. High-Intensity LED Technology
The L 810 utilizes high-intensity LEDs that provide bright, long-lasting illumination. Unlike incandescent or halogen lights, LEDs consume less power while delivering consistent visibility over long distances. This makes the L 810 ideal for both daytime and nighttime applications.
2. Energy Efficiency and Sustainability
LED technology significantly reduces energy consumption, making the L 810 an environmentally friendly choice. With lower power requirements, these lights contribute to reduced operational costs and a smaller carbon footprint.
3. Durability and Weather Resistance
Constructed with robust materials, the L 810 is designed to withstand harsh weather conditions, including heavy rain, snow, and extreme temperatures. Its corrosion-resistant housing ensures long-term reliability in outdoor environments.
4. Compliance with Aviation Regulations
The L 810 meets international aviation standards, including FAA (Federal Aviation Administration) and ICAO (International Civil Aviation Organization) requirements. This compliance ensures that the light provides adequate visibility for pilots, enhancing overall airspace safety.

5. Low Maintenance Requirements
Thanks to the extended lifespan of LEDs, the L 810 requires minimal maintenance. This reduces downtime and operational disruptions, making it a cost-effective solution for infrastructure owners.
Applications of the L 810 LED Obstruction Light
1. Telecommunication Towers
Tall communication towers pose a significant risk to low-flying aircraft. The L 810 is widely used to mark these structures, ensuring they remain visible to pilots at all times.

2. Wind Turbines
As wind farms expand, the need for reliable obstruction lighting increases. The L 810 is commonly installed on wind turbines to prevent collisions and comply with aviation safety regulations.
3. High-Rise Buildings and Skyscrapers
In urban areas, tall buildings must be clearly marked to avoid aviation hazards. The L 810 provides the necessary illumination to enhance visibility for both manned and unmanned aircraft.
4. Bridges and Power Lines
Large bridges and high-voltage power lines also require obstruction lighting. The L 810 ensures these structures are easily identifiable, reducing potential risks to air traffic.
Advantages Over Traditional Obstruction Lights
Longer Lifespan: LEDs last significantly longer than traditional bulbs, reducing replacement frequency.
Lower Power Consumption: Energy savings translate to reduced operational costs.
Enhanced Visibility: Brighter and more consistent light output improves safety.
Reduced Heat Emission: LEDs generate less heat, minimizing the risk of overheating.
